What Causes The Fecal Material To Pass Into The Vagina?

Question: Under what circumstances could feces exit from the vagina as opposed to the anise?

Your concern about passage of faecal matter from the vagina is absolutely right.

In a normal situation, there is no chance of faecal matter to pass from the vagina.

In rare cases, when there is a communication channel between rectum and vagina then the only faecal matter can pass through the vagina.
This condition is known as a Recto-vaginal fistula.
